DESCRIPTION:News of the war in Ukraine reaches us through many channels: 
 social media\\, news services\\, the press\\, television\\, the internet.
  Yet we rarely have the chance to listen directly to those who have lived
  through it. In the unique project I Didn't Leave Ukraine (which is part 
 of the broader project Who Am I? )\\, Estonian director Merle Karusoo –
  known for her biographical theatre works – gives voice to veterans of 
 the war that still rages just beyond our border\\, even as we increasingl
 y try to look away. This performance does not allow us such comfort. A fa
 ce-to-face encounter with veterans speaking about their experiences shake
 s the audience to the core. The protagonists bear witness to their courag
 e and sacrifice\\, sharing their memories with brutal honesty and immedia
 cy. Colliding in their stories are helplessness and determination\\, and 
 degradation and pride. In Karusoo’s drama\\, “Slava Ukraini!” – t
 he cry resounding all over the world in expression of solidarity with the
  people fighting in Ukraine for freedom and democracy not only for their 
 own country – is shouted by those who have irretrievably lost their hea
 lth and physical strength in that war. A shocking theme in this theatrica
 l encounter is desertion\\, refusal to participate in war. When such an a
 ttitude is condemned by politicians speaking from the safety of their off
 ice armchairs\\, we may be inclined to consider them right. But it takes 
 on a wholly different meaning when the right to preserve your life and sa
 fety is discussed by those whose lives were truly jeopardized. I Didn't L
 eave Ukraine compels us to ask difficult questions about life after war\\
 , the trauma that has become a collective experience\\, and about solidar
 ity – whether with those who fight\\, or those who choose to give up th
 e fight. Merle Karusoo's dramatic text I Didn't Leave Ukraine – Origina
